Cleveland SteamCraft Ultra 10 two-compartment, floor-model convection steamer previously used at the Van Gogh 360 museum in Salt Lake City, Utah.
This high-capacity commercial steamer features:
- Two stacked cooking compartments
- Independent controls for each compartment
- Mechanical cooking timers
- Manual continuous-steaming settings
- Individual power controls
- Heavy-duty manual door latches
- Stainless-steel exterior and cooking compartments
- Integrated condensation collection trough
- Ground-level drainage connection
- Adjustable stainless-steel legs
- Operating instruction placards
The steamer is reported to work. Both compartments and the door-latching mechanisms were operational during the unit’s previous use. It has not been tested under an extended cooking load for this auction, and the seller does not guarantee specific temperature, pressure or steam-production performance.
